Source: http://www.gamersnexus.net/hwreviews/3015-amd-threadripper-1950x-1920x-review?showall=1Per-core overclocking is not available on Threadripper, and won’t be. Overclocking can be done in core pairs, with OC expectations similar to Ryzen. AMD noted that the Threadripper CPUs consist of the top 5% of presorted Ryzen dies (though later changed this number to 2%, depending on who was talking).
